* In ''Film/DoctorAtSea'', Corble has a pain in his tooth, so Dr. Sparrow has to use pliers to extricate the molar. The only issue is the tooth is so hard to remove that attempting to do so sends Corble, Dr. Sparrow, and Easter all crashing to the floor. Trail, who also has a toothache, witnesses this and leaves as soon as possible.

* ''Literature/TasteOfMarrow'' by Creator/SarahGailey. After a gang kidnaps her baby, Adelia Reyes wakes up one of the men they left behind by slapping him so hard she [[TeethFlying knocks out a tooth]], then proceeds to yank out several more by hand until he reveals where the others took her child. Surprisingly she lets him live but puts one of his teeth in her pocket and warns that if he was lying, she'll be back for its mate on the other side of his jaw.

* Dry socket. It's ''exactly'' what it sounds like. Basically, after a tooth extraction, a blood clot forms over the empty socket that begins the healing process. However, depending on how well the patient followed their dentist's instructions, the clot can actually become dislodged, exposing the empty socket and ''the jaw bone'' underneath. It is a painful, long-lasting experience that delays the healing process by quite a bit. The pain is so severe that it can be felt across the sufferer's face, and can be ''immobilizing''. Thankfully, most tooth extractions have only a 5 percent chance of leading to this. The only exceptions are the lower wisdom teeth, in which dry socket happens ''30 percent'' of the time. Note for those worried, if you think you may have a dry socket, you most likely don't. ''You will know the second it happens.''
